Guadix (Ar. Wādī Āsh) is a small city in northeastern Granada Province, less than 64 kilometers (40 miles) from the city of Granada, on the left bank of the river Guadix, a subtributary of the Guadiana Menor. In Roman times it was called Acci (Accitum); two Roman legions were garrisoned there to guard the surrounding mountains. In the second century it was the seat of one of the first bishops of the Peninsula. Ronda (Ar. Runda) is a small Andalusian city about 105 kilometers (65 miles) northwest of Malaga. It is situated in a very mountainous area 701 meters (2,300 feet) above sea level and is divided in two by the river Guadalevín, which carves out a steep canyon. The old Celtic settlement of Arunda had commercial contacts with the Phoenicians and Greeks, and then was under Roman rule.
